Address
1100 OXFORD EXCHANGE BLVD, Oxford, AL 36203
State
City
Phone number to Denon - Oxford in Oxford, Alabama
(256) 832-0172
Website
https://www.denon.com
N/A
Driving directions
GPS: 33.609325, -85.781062

Content last modification: 10/22/2024 12:04 PM
Other Denon locations near me:
- Denon - Hoover at 3780 RIVERCHASE VLG - Hoover, Alabama
- Denon - Montgomery at 7927 Vaughn Road - Montgomery, Alabama
- Denon - Montgomery at 1580 N EASTERN BLVD - Montgomery, Alabama
- Denon - Montgomery at 8125 L Decker Ln - Montgomery, Alabama
- Denon - Montgomery at 663 N. Eastern Blvd. - Montgomery, Alabama
Looking for another location of Denon store?
Go to Denon store locator to see all Denon stores